Corresponding Angles – Two nonadjacent angles on the same side of a transversal such that one is an exterior angle and the other is an interior angle. 6. Vertical Angles – Two non adjacent angles formed by a pair of intersecting lines that share a vertex 7. Same-side Interior Angles – Two nonadjacent angles in the same side of a ...
